Sulfuration of glycine tert-Bu ester derivatives by phase transfer catalysis was tried to provide. The best condition was using TEBA as catalyst, 50% KOH as alk. and THF as solvent. α-Sulfuration reaction by phase transfer catalysis was successfully made, and ee in asymmetry could up to 70%.
